Aralkuli Population - Paschim Medinipur, West Bengal
Aralkuli is a small village located in Jamboni Block of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al with total 41 families residing. The Aralkuli village has population of 160 of which 83 are males while 77 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Aralkuli village population of children with age 0-6 is 19 which makes up 11.88 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Aralkuli village is 928 which is lower than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Aralkuli as per census is 1375, higher than West Bengal average of 956.
Aralkuli village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Aralkuli village was 51.06 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Aralkuli Male literacy stands at 69.33 % while female literacy rate was 30.30 %.

Aralkuli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 41 | - | - |
Population | 160 | 83 | 77 |
Child (0-6) | 19 | 8 | 11 |
Schedule Caste | 94 | 49 | 45 |
Schedule Tribe | 66 | 34 | 32 |
Literacy | 51.06 % | 69.33 % | 30.30 % |
Total Workers | 63 | 43 | 20 |
Main Worker | 49 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 14 | 4 | 10 |
